WellPoint Nets Tumbles on Investment Loss (TheStreet.com)

The health insurer said fourth-quarter earnings fell 61% as it recorded net realized investment losses of $350.5 million.


Investment fund manager facing fraud charges surrenders (CNN)

A missing Florida fund manager — whose $300 million in investment funds are actually worth less than $1 million, according to a federal lawsuit — has turned himself in to face fraud charges, the FBI said Tuesday.


Satyam Appoints Management Advisor, Investment Banks (PC World via Yahoo! News)

The board of Satyam Computer Services has appointed The Boston Consulting Group as management advisor, and Goldman Sachs and Avendus, an Indian investment bank, as investment bankers to advise the company on various strategic options, including bringing in a large investor in the company.
